    For the record, reference push up (the way it's supposed to be done in the military):

    -Only parts of your body that can come in contact with the floor are your hands, toes and a slight tap of the chin and/or chest;
    -Feet and knees always together;
    -Legs stay perfectly straight and aligned with torso the whole time, head looking forward (to avoid hitting your nose on the floor, not cool);
    -Hands are low and tucked close to the ribs (sort of like a CGBP);
    -Chest taps the floor every repetition;
    -Elbows lock every repetition;
    -And remember, your back and hips NEVER move!

    Compare with typical push up form:

    -Elbows flared like a guillotine press;
    -Lots of moving the spine and hips for momentum and leverage;
    -Down to 3 inches off the floor and back up and call that one push up;
    -Feet wide apart to reduce workload;
    -Etc etc (I've seen **** you wouldn't believe, how hilarious it was).
